25:35Now PlayingIn this episode of The Urban Debate with Shreya Dhoundial, we will discuss Karnataka's High Court's observation about reducing the age of Consensual sex. According to Live Law on Sunday, the Protection of Children from Sexual Offenses, or POCSO, Act, the Karnataka High Court has requested that the Law Commission reconsider the legal minimum age of consent. According to the POCSO Act, the legal age of consent for sex in India is 18. Sexual contact with a girl under the age of 18 is considered rape, and her consent is not deemed to be legitimate.
High Court today asked the law commission to rethink consent laws for couples to have sex. Deepika Bhardwaj activist, said, ' it is deplorable to see a school-going boy charged with rape cases after consensual sex.'
